excel怎么输入现在时间

excel怎么输入现在时间

要在Excel中输入当前时间,可以使用快捷键、公式、或者VBA宏。快捷键、公式、VBA宏,是最常用的方法。下面将详细介绍如何使用这三种方法来实现这一目标。

一、快捷键

快捷键是最快速、最简单的方法之一。Excel提供了一个专门的快捷键来插入当前时间。

使用快捷键插入当前时间

  1. 选择你希望插入时间的单元格。
  2. 按下 Ctrl + Shift + ; 键(Windows)或 Command + Shift + ; 键(Mac)。

这将直接在选定的单元格中插入当前时间,格式通常为 HH:MM:SS

二、公式

如果你希望时间随着每次表格的更新自动更新,那么可以使用公式。

使用公式插入当前时间

在Excel中,可以使用 =NOW() 函数。这不仅会插入当前时间,还会插入当前日期。

  1. 选择你希望插入时间的单元格。
  2. 输入公式 =NOW() 然后按下 Enter 键。

注意: 这个公式会在每次工作表重新计算时更新。这意味着只要有任何数据发生变化,时间都会随之更新。如果你只需要时间而不需要日期,可以使用 =TEXT(NOW(),"HH:MM:SS") 公式来仅显示时间。

三、VBA宏

使用VBA宏可以为Excel增加更多的灵活性和功能。通过编写一个简单的宏,可以在任何特定的事件中插入当前时间。

使用VBA宏插入当前时间

  1. 按下 Alt + F11 打开VBA编辑器。
  2. 在VBA编辑器中,选择 Insert > Module 来插入一个新模块。
  3. 在模块中输入以下代码:

Sub InsertCurrentTime()

ActiveCell.Value = Format(Now, "HH:MM:SS")

End Sub

  1. 关闭VBA编辑器并回到Excel。
  2. 选择你希望插入时间的单元格,然后按下 Alt + F8,选择你刚刚创建的 InsertCurrentTime 宏,然后点击 运行

四、如何选择合适的方法

每种方法都有其特定的使用场景和优缺点。

快捷键

优点: 快速、简单、无需复杂设置。

缺点: 每次都需要手动插入,不会自动更新。

公式

优点: 自动更新,每次工作表重新计算时都会更新。

缺点: 如果不希望时间自动更新,这可能会造成困扰。

VBA宏

优点: 灵活、可以与各种事件结合使用。

缺点: 需要一些编程知识,设置相对复杂。

五、实际应用案例

在实际工作中,不同的方法适用于不同的场景。

财务报表

在财务报表中,通常需要记录数据更新的时间。在这种情况下,使用 =NOW() 公式是一个不错的选择,因为它可以确保每次数据更新时,时间也会随之更新。

项目管理

在项目管理中,通常需要记录某个任务的完成时间。使用快捷键可以快速记录时间,避免了繁琐的手动输入。

数据分析

在数据分析中,可能需要在特定的事件发生时记录时间。例如,当某个特定条件满足时,记录当前时间。此时,可以使用VBA宏来实现这一需求。

六、注意事项

在使用这些方法时,有几点需要注意:

  1. 时间格式:确保时间格式符合你的需求。可以通过修改单元格格式来调整显示的时间格式。
  2. 自动更新:如果使用 =NOW() 公式,确保你了解它会在每次工作表重新计算时更新。
  3. VBA宏安全:在使用VBA宏时,确保启用了宏并且信任所使用的代码。

七、总结

在Excel中输入当前时间有多种方法,包括快捷键、公式和VBA宏。每种方法都有其特定的使用场景和优缺点。根据具体需求选择合适的方法,可以提高工作效率,确保数据的准确性和及时性。通过掌握这些技巧,你可以更灵活地处理时间记录和管理任务。

相关问答FAQs:

1. 如何在Excel中输入当前时间?

  • 问题: 我想在Excel表格中输入当前时间,应该如何操作?
  • 回答: 您可以使用以下两种方法在Excel中输入当前时间:
    • 方法一:在单元格中直接输入函数 "=NOW()",按下回车键即可显示当前日期和时间。
    • 方法二:使用快捷键Ctrl+; 输入当前日期,再使用空格或者输入时间的函数 "=TIME()" 输入当前时间。

2. 如何在Excel中自动更新现在时间?

  • 问题: 我想在Excel中实现自动更新当前时间,该怎么做?
  • 回答: 您可以使用以下方法在Excel中自动更新当前时间:
    • 方法一:在单元格中输入函数 "=NOW()",然后在Excel中启用自动计算功能(默认情况下是启用的),这样每次打开或修改表格时,当前时间都会自动更新。
    • 方法二:使用宏来实现自动更新时间。您可以编写一个宏,并将其与特定事件(例如工作表的打开、保存或修改)关联,以便在特定事件发生时更新时间。

3. 如何在Excel中显示当前时间的特定格式?

  • 问题: 我想在Excel中以特定的格式显示当前时间,应该如何设置?
  • 回答: 您可以按照以下步骤在Excel中显示当前时间的特定格式:
    • 选择要显示时间的单元格,然后右键单击并选择“格式单元格”选项。
    • 在“数字”选项卡中,选择“自定义”类别。
    • 在“类型”框中,输入您想要的时间格式代码。例如,如果您想要显示时间的格式为“小时:分钟:秒”,则输入"hh:mm:ss"。
    • 单击“确定”按钮,您将看到单元格中显示的时间按照您指定的格式进行显示。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4743906

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部